Understanding Micronutrients: The Building Blocks of Health
While macronutrients like carbohydrates, proteins, and fats provide the body with energy, micronutrients are the essential vitamins and minerals needed in much smaller quantities to enable a vast array of vital biological processes. These include regulating metabolism, supporting immune function, and facilitating growth and development. Deficiencies, often called 'hidden hunger,' can slowly and silently lead to serious health issues over time. A balanced diet rich in a variety of fruits, vegetables, whole grains, lean proteins, and fortified foods is the best way to ensure adequate intake.
The Critical Role of Individual Micronutrients
Different micronutrients serve unique and critical functions in the body. They are generally categorized into vitamins (organic compounds) and minerals (inorganic elements). Here are eight of the most crucial micronutrients for human health:
- Vitamin A (Retinol & Carotenoids): This fat-soluble vitamin is vital for good vision, immune system function, and proper cell growth. Deficiency can lead to night blindness and weakened immune defenses.
- Vitamin C (Ascorbic Acid): A water-soluble vitamin and potent antioxidant, vitamin C is necessary for wound healing, collagen production for healthy skin, bones, and teeth, and strengthening the immune system. The body cannot produce it, so dietary intake is essential.
- Vitamin D: Often called the 'sunshine vitamin,' this nutrient is crucial for calcium absorption, bone health, muscle function, and a strong immune system. Deficiency is a widespread problem, and while sunlight is the primary source, it's also found in some foods.
- Iron: This essential mineral is a key component of hemoglobin in red blood cells, which transports oxygen from the lungs to the rest of the body. Iron deficiency is a major cause of anemia, leading to fatigue, weakness, and impaired cognitive function.
- Zinc: An important trace mineral, zinc is involved in immune function, wound healing, protein synthesis, and proper growth and development. It supports the immune system in fighting off invading bacteria and viruses.
- Iodine: The thyroid gland uses iodine to produce hormones that control metabolism, growth, and development. Severe deficiency can cause goiter and, if during pregnancy, can lead to cognitive impairments in the child.
- Folate (Vitamin B9): Crucial for proper cell division and the formation of genetic material like DNA and RNA. It is particularly important during pregnancy to prevent birth defects of the brain and spine.
- Magnesium: Involved in over 300 enzyme reactions, magnesium plays a role in nerve and muscle function, blood pressure regulation, immune system support, and maintaining strong bones.
Food Sources and Deficiency Symptoms
Ensuring a balanced intake of a variety of foods is the best strategy for getting enough of these micronutrients. Different food groups provide different nutrients, highlighting the importance of dietary diversity.
- Food sources: A diverse diet should include leafy greens, citrus fruits, nuts, seeds, legumes, seafood, and fortified cereals to cover the range of micronutrient needs.
- Deficiency symptoms: Symptoms vary widely and can include fatigue (iron, folate), poor night vision (vitamin A), brittle hair and nails (biotin, zinc), mouth ulcers (B vitamins, iron), and weakened immunity (zinc, vitamin C).
Comparison of Essential Micronutrients
| Micronutrient | Primary Function | Food Sources | Deficiency Symptoms |
|---|---|---|---|
| Vitamin A | Vision, immune function, cell growth | Organ meats, dairy, sweet potatoes, carrots | Night blindness, impaired immune system |
| Vitamin C | Wound healing, collagen production, immune support | Citrus fruits, berries, bell peppers | Bleeding gums, slow wound healing, weakened immunity |
| Vitamin D | Calcium absorption, bone health | Sunlight, fatty fish, fortified dairy | Rickets in children, osteoporosis in adults, muscle weakness |
| Iron | Oxygen transport in blood | Red meat, lentils, spinach, fortified cereals | Anemia, fatigue, weakness, impaired cognitive function |
| Zinc | Immune function, wound healing, growth | Oysters, red meat, beans, nuts | Poor immunity, hair loss, delayed wound healing |
| Iodine | Thyroid hormone production | Iodized salt, seafood, dairy | Goiter, fatigue, impaired mental function |
| Folate (B9) | Cell division, DNA synthesis | Leafy greens, liver, asparagus, legumes | Fatigue, weakness, neural tube defects in infants |
| Magnesium | Enzyme reactions, nerve & muscle function | Almonds, cashews, spinach, black beans | Muscle cramps, fatigue, sleep disturbances |
Conclusion: Prioritizing Micronutrient Intake
Micronutrients, though required in small amounts, are indispensable for maintaining good health. Ensuring adequate intake of essential vitamins like A, C, and D and minerals such as iron, zinc, and iodine, can help prevent a wide range of health issues, from anemia to developmental problems. The most effective approach is to consume a varied and colorful diet. While supplements can help fill nutritional gaps, they should not be a substitute for a healthy eating pattern. Consulting a healthcare professional can provide personalized advice on your specific micronutrient needs and whether supplementation is necessary.
